ORCL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2023 in Review

2,529 of the 6,302 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Oracle (ORCL) for Q3 2023, worth a combined $124B — down 11% from $139B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 163 funds closed out of ORCL and 156 opened new positions — a net loss of 7 holders — while 953 trimmed existing stakes and 1,015 added.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$936M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$461M.
